
Editor’s Note: The following information was supplied by the Quogue Village Police Department. A criminal charge is only an accusation and does not indicate guilt.
Quogue police charged Carlos Pelaez, 27, of East Moriches, with DWI, a misdemeanor and first degree aggravated unlicensed, a felony.
Police said they pulled Pelaez over on Montauk Highway on Nov. 30 at 3:05 a.m. for failure to stay in his lane and for crossing over a double line.
The felony charge, said police, is based on a prior DWI conviction and because Pelaez had a suspended license.
